The Frascati manual is written by, and for the benefit of, the national experts on R&D statistics of the OECD member countries, who collect and process national R&D input data. Main concepts and terms are explained in the manual. Guidelines are presented for collecting and processing R&D data. Thus, the manual presents the common guidelines of the OECD member countries in order to obtain comparable R&D statistics across the country borders. The Frascati manual is published by OECD. The sixth edition was issued in 2002.

Frascati-manualen på norsk

In June 2004 excerpts of the sixth edition of the Frascati manual were translated into Norwegian at NIFU. The translation is available at the institute on request, and is also downloadable as a pdf document.
